The requirements for the issuance of a temporary restraining order and/or a preliminary injunction are:
- substantial likelihood that the moving party will prevail on the merits;
- the moving party will otherwise suffer irreparable injury;
- the moving party's threatened injury outweighs any damage to the non-moving party if the injunction issues; and,
- if issued, the injunction will not be adverse to public interest.
ULBA v. Leavitt, 256 F.3d 1061, 1066 (10th Cir. 2001);
SCFC ILC, Inc. v. VISA USA, Inc., 936 F.2d 1096, 1098 (10th Cir. 1991).
